Mission and Program Overview

Mission

Rafi-usa challenges the root causes of unjust food systems, supporting and advocating for economically, racially and ecologically just farms communities.

Governance Explanations

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 11B

Upon completion, audited financial statements and form 990 are distributed to the board. Audit finance committee members meet with auditor to review. Treasurer/ audit finance chair provides report to the board. The board formally accepts audited financial statements and form 990.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 12C

Compliance with the conflict of interest policy is monitored whenever a situation arises that could be a potential conflict of interest. Additionally, disclosures by staff and board members are made annually.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 15

The organization's salary structure integrates comparability data obtained from a market compensation study obtained in 2019 from the nc center for nonprofits and in-house completed in 2019. The study was based on market rates for comparable jobs in comparable organizations (size, nonprofit, field, position, etc.). The current structure was revised and adopted by the board of directors in 2021.

IRS990/Desc0AGRICULTURAL ENTERPRISE DEVELOPMENT: OUR EXPANDING FARMERS MARKET ACCESS (EFMA) PROJECT COORDINATES TWO FOOD ACCESS INCENTIVE PROGRAMS, FRESH BUCKS AND DOUBLE BUCKS, AT 23 NORTH CAROLINA FARMERS MARKETS, MOBILE MARKETS, AND CO-OP GROCERIES TO IMPROVE FOOD ACCESS AND INCLUSIVITY FOR COMMUNITY MEMBERS, AS WELL AS, PROVIDE SMALL FARMERS NEW SALE OUTLETS. EFMA PROVIDES T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E TO MARKET MANAGERS AND WORKS TO DEVELOP, COORDINATE, AND EXPAND DIRECT PRODUCER-TO-CONSUMER MARKETS THAT MAKE LOCALLY PRODUCED FOODS MORE AVAILABLE AND ACCESSIBLE AND SUPPORT FARMERS AND FOOD ENTREPRENEURS OF COLOR.IN 2017, RAFI-USA FOUNDED THE FARMERS OF COLOR NETWORK (FOCN) TO MORE INTENTIONALLY SUPPORT BLACK, INDIGENOUS, AND PEOPLE OF COLOR (BIPOC) FARMERS IN THE SOUTHEAST WITH THE GOALS OF IMPROVING THEIR ECONOMIC VIABILITY, KEEPING THEIR LAND, AND GAINING GENERATIONAL INVESTMENT. FOCN PROVIDES FARMER-LED T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E, MARKET ACCESS OPPORTUNITIES, WEBINARS, FARM TOURS, NETWORKING EVENTS, AND GATHERINGS TO HIGHLIGHT ANCESTRAL TRADITIONS AND KNOWLEDGE.IN 2020, FOCN ENTERED INTO THE SARE PROJECT, NAVIGATING FARM FINANCIAL & MENTAL HEALTH CRISES, IN PARTNERSHIP WITH NORTH CAROLINA STATE UNIVERSITY, THE LAND LOSS PREVENTION PROJECT, THE NORTH CAROLINA AGROMEDICINE INSTITUTE, AND THE NATIONAL CENTER FOR APPROPRIATE TECHNOLOGY AND FUNDED BY SUSTAINABLE AGRICULTURE RESEARCH & EDUCATION (SARE) TO REDUCE THE LOSS OF FARMS AND LIVES BY RESEARCHING AND TESTING CULTURALLY RESPONSIVE INFORMATION AND INFORMATION DELIVERY THAT ADDRESSES THE COMBINED FINANCIAL, LAND TENURE, AND MENTAL HEALTH ISSUES FACED BY FARM FAMILIES IN SEVERE FINANCIAL DISTRESS.

I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y2Grp/Desc0COME TO THE TABLE: COME TO THE TABLE IS A MULTI-FACED PROGRAM THAT FOCUSES ON SYSTEMIC SOLUTIONS TO FOOD ACCESS THAT ALSO STRENGTHEN JUST AND SUSTAINABLE AGRICULTURE. THE PROGRAM WORKS WITH FAITH COMMUNITIES, HUNGER RELIEF ADVOCATES AND FARMERS TO ENGAGE AND MOBILIZE THEM ON ISSUES OF FOOD ACCESS AND JUSTICE IN THE FOOD SYSTEM. THE PROGRAM DELIVERS CONFERENCES AND EVENTS, T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E, TRAINING FOCUSED ON BUILDING EQUITY IN THE FOOD SYSTEM, AND COLLABORATE NETWORKS AND RESOURCES.

I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y3Grp/Desc0FISCAL SPONSORSHIPS: RAFI PROVIDES FISCAL SPONSORSHIP SERVICES TO HELP FACILITATE THE MISSION-RELATED WORK OF PARTNER INITIATIVES THAT LACK THE LEGAL STATUS OR ADMINISTRATIVE CAPACITY NECESSARY TO RECEIVE GRANTS OR DONATIONS. RAFI SERVES AS FISCAL SPONSOR FOR THE FOLLOWING GROUPS:-NATIONAL ORGANIC COALITION- NOC IS A NATIONAL ALLIANCE OF ORGANIZATIONS WORKING TO PROVIDE A "WASHINGTON VOICE" FOR FARMERS, RANCHERS, ENVIRONMENTALISTS, CONSUMERS AND INDUSTRY MEMBERS INVOLVED IN ORGANIC AGRICULTURE.-DURHAM FARMERS MARKET'S DOUBLE BUCKS PROGRAM-DOUBLE BUCKS IS AN INCENTIVE PROGRAM AT THE DURHAM FARMERS' MARKET THAT PROVIDES UP TO $10 IN MATCHING FUNDS PER CUSTOMER FOR PURCHASES MADE WITH SNAP BENEFITS.- CAMPAIGN FOR CONTRACT AGRICULTURE REFORM - CCAR IS A NATIONAL ALLIANCE OF ORGANIZATIONS WORKING TO PROVIDE A VOICE FOR MEMBERS AND RANCHERS INVOLVED IN CONTRACT AGRICULTURE, AS WELL AS THE COMMUNITIES IN WHICH THEY LIVE.

I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ActyOtherGrp/Desc0FARM ADVOCACY: FARM ADVOCACY PROVIDES ASSISTANCE, DEVELOPS TOOLS AND RESOURCES, AND PROMOTES POLICIES THAT HELP FARMERS ATTAIN GREATER FINANCIAL STABILITY AND ENCOURAGE THRIVING AND SUSTAINABLE SMALL AND MID-SCALE FAMILY FARMS. THE PROGRAM EDUCATES FARMERS ABOUT MANAGING RISK AND EQUIPS THEM TO NAVIGATE FEDERAL FARM PROGRAMS. THE PROGRAM PROVIDES INDIVIDUAL COUNSELING AND ASSISTANCE TO FARMERS FACING FINANCIAL CRISIS AND WHO STAND TO LOSE THEIR FARMS WITHOUT IMMEDIATE SUPPORT.CHALLENGING CORPORATE POWER: CHALLENGING CORPORATE POWER WORKS TO HOLD CORPORATIONS AND GOVERNMENT ACCOUNTABLE TO CURB THE ADVERSE EFFECTS OF LIVESTOCK CONCENTRATION AND BUILD ALTERNATIVE, INCLUSIVE LIVESTOCK ECONOMIES THAT EQUITABLY DISTRIBUTE PROFITS ACROSS FARMERS, RURAL COMMUNITIES, AND CONSUMERS. THE FISCALLY SPONSORED PROJECT, CAMPAIGN FOR CONTRACT AGRICULTURE REFORM (CCAR) IS INCLUDED AS PART OF THIS PROGRAM. JUST FOODS: FROM PROMOTING MEANINGFUL STANDARDS FOR ORGANIC AGRICULTURE, TO PIONEERING NEW STANDARDS FOR SOCIAL JUSTICE IN THE FOOD SYSTEM, JUST FOODS PROJECTS SEEK TO MAKE FAIR, SUSTAINABLE FARMING A VIABLE CHOICE. PROTECTING AGRICULTURAL GENETIC DIVERSITY IS ALSO ESSENTIAL TO THE VIABILITY OF FAMILY FARMS. THEREFORE, JUST FOODS ADVOCATES FOR FUNDING FOR CLASSICAL BREEDING PROGRAMS AND SUPPORT PUBLICLY-HELD SEEDS AND BREEDS. WITHIN THE JUST FOODS PROGRAM ARE THE PROJECTS: FARMERS OF COLOR NETWORK AND EXPANDING FARMERS MARKET ACCESS.
